Crosman Model-38T internal parts 

With thanks to Bill.

Note: the top one is a later .177 cal and the bottom one an earlier .22 cal.

Bill said:

Pic of my two fully restored Crosman 38T air pistols. Top one is .177, and I think it’s what is called the third version. Probably late 1970s to mid-1980s, but not sure how to date it. Serial number 127803530.

Bottom one is .22 and based on paperwork in original box that was printed in May 1969, my guess it was made in late 1969. It’s has the early brass valve, which is slightly larger and heavier than the later zinc-based valve.
